Abstract

The utility model discloses a marine boiler safety valve which comprises a valve body. The valve body is provided with a liquid inlet, a liquid outlet and a valve element hole; the liquid outlet and the liquid inlet are communicated through the valve element hole, and a valve element mechanism is arranged in the valve element hole; the valve element mechanism comprises a valve element, a valve rod and a pressure control device, wherein the valve rod is arranged on the valve element, and the pressure control device is arranged on the valve rod; the top end of the valve rod penetrates out of the valve body, the valve rod and a valve base are connected in a sealing mode, the pressure control device is arranged on the portion, penetrating out of the valve body, of the valve rod, a valve element seat is arranged in the valve element hole, the valve element is movably arranged on the valve element seat, an upper circular-arc groove is formed in the outer side of a sealing face of the valve element, and a corresponding lower circular-arc groove is formed in the outer side of the upper surface of the valve element seat. The marine boiler safety valve can effectively keep the steam pressure of a boiler stable.

Background technique
Marine boiler belongs to a kind of pressurized container, and its working medium mostly is steam,, in order to guarantee the stable of vapor pressure, needs to use boiler safety valve keep the stable of pressure, prevents superpressure, overload and the phenomenon that boiler is blasted occurs.General safety valve is due to the structural design of itself, while there will be overpressure, and the situation of the dumb in time pressure release of safety valve work.

The beneficial effects of the utility model are: because the outside on the sealing surface of spool is provided with upper arc groove, the valve core case upper surface outside also is provided with corresponding lower arc groove, vapor pressure superelevation in boiler, vapor pressure overcomes load on spring band movable valve plug and opens, vapor pressure enters upper and lower arc groove, can produce reverse impulse force, can improve fast the Lift of spool, increase discharge amount, reach effective quick pressure releasing.
Because described valve body is provided with two spool bore and two spool control mechanisms, in the time of can guaranteeing the pipe-line system superpressure, have at least a spool can open pressure release, guaranteed the safety of whole pipe-line system.
Owing to being provided with lift lever and promoting spanner, can be used for checking the degree of flexibility of valve disc, also can be used for the manual emergency pressure release.
Because spool is provided with shoulder hole, comprise tapped hole and the larger circular hole of lower diameter that upper diameter is less, the valve rod bottom is provided with the threaded boss that matches with the spool upper screwed hole, valve rod convex platform end face to the distance of valve rod bottom less than the circular hole degree of depth on spool, pack into spool and make boss be arranged in circular hole on spool of valve rod rotation, adopt and be flexibly connected between spool and valve rod, can prevent that false touch from promoting spanner and causing safety valve to open.
